Bon Jovi Win Award at 3D Film Festival
From the Bon Jovi website:
The world’s first and largest all 3D Film & Music Festival (3DFF) ended its 4-day run closing with the Disclosure Project concert at Avalon Hollywood and an award ceremony celebrating the best of its 3D film & music programs. Bon Jovi won an award for Best 3DTV Project for "What's Next" presented by AEG Live & Network Live.

Memphis Dallas Shout-out
Thanks, FD, for dropping this info in my inbox. The video is too cute.
For information on Memphis in the Dallas area, visit the website for Dallas Summer Musicals.
MEMPHIS takes place in the smoky halls and underground clubs of the segregated 50’s, a young white DJ named Huey Calhoun fell in love with everything he shouldn't: rock and roll and an electrifying black singer. MEMPHIS is an original story about the cultural revolution that erupted when his vision met her voice, and the music changed forever.
MEMPHIS will launch a US National Tour in (where else!) Memphis, TN beginning in October 2011 at the Orpheum Theatre.
MEMPHIS is currently playing on Broadway at the Shubert Theatre.
